Antibiotics are an incredibly important class of drugs and possibly the most impactful, life-changing scientific innovation in history. However, microorganisms reproduce themselves very rapidly and can evolve in literal minutes. We can’t iterate science this quickly, which is the basis of increasing cases of antibiotic resistance that are a growing concern in modern medicine.

Antibiotics are complex both chemically and in their biological function, which makes them hard to develop and a relatively unattractive pharmaceutical class from the business perspective. Like never before, we need a fresh perspective, and this is where Ziyang Zhang is leaving an impression.

Ziyang is young, but incredibly productive and creative. Even before starting with his own research group (soon at Berkley), he has achieved so much and shown incredible chemical talent and thinking unlike anyone else’s. His new way of thinking can affect drug development strategies for antibiotics and beyond.

This is a captivating discussion with an incredible character, that fascinates with his understated style as he introduces us to his chemistry and his ideas. In a classic BCTL way, we explore his personal and professional path, his research into macrolide antibiotics, and his novel approach to selectively targeting brain cancer.
